If you see the warning:
“Time gap detected. Variable rates should have a 1-minute gap between each range.”
This means your variable rates are not connected properly.
How Variable Rates Work
Variable rates let you charge different prices for the same rate name throughout the day.
All variable rates must:
Use the exact same name
Cover time continuously across the day
Birrdi treats these as one rate that changes based on time.
The Key Rule
There must be NO gaps and NO overlaps between time ranges.
Each time block must touch exactly.
Correct Setup ✅
Your times should connect perfectly:
8:00 AM – 2:59 PM
3:00 PM – 9:00 PM
✔ No missing minutes
✔ No overlap
✔ Clean transition
Incorrect Setup ❌ (Gap)
8:00 AM – 2:59 PM
3:05 PM – 9:00 PM
🚫 Missing time between 3:00–3:04 PM
Birrdi sees this as the rate being unavailable during that gap.
Incorrect Setup ❌ (Overlap)
8:00 AM – 3:00 PM
3:00 PM – 9:00 PM
🚫 Overlapping at 3:00 PM
This also breaks the rate logic.
Why This Matters
If there’s even a 1-minute gap or overlap, Birrdi cannot properly calculate pricing across a reservation.
This can cause:
Rates appearing unavailable
Booking errors
Incorrect pricing behavior
How to Fix It
Go to your Rates
Review each time range for the same rate name
Make sure:
The next rate starts exactly 1 minute after the previous ends
No time is skipped
No times overlap
Quick Tip
When in doubt:
End one rate at 2:59 PM
Start the next at 3:00 PM
That keeps everything aligned.
If you’re still seeing this error, double-check every rate in the group — one misaligned time block will break the entire setup.
